mac执行python3 --version报错

报错问题:在Mac系统中执行python3 --version时报错。

可能的解释:

  1. Python未安装或未正确安装。

  2. 系统变量设置不正确,导致命令行无法找到python3命令。

解决方法:

  1. 检查Python是否安装:在终端执行python3 --versionpython --version。如果没有安装,需要先安装Python。

    复制代码
    python3 --version
  2. 如果Python已安装,可能是环境变量设置问题。可以尝试以下步骤:

    • 查找Python安装路径:使用which python3which python查找Python的安装路径。

      复制代码
      which python3
    • 如果找到路径,可以尝试直接使用完整路径运行Python,例如/usr/local/bin/python3 --version

    • 如果上述命令都没有返回正确的版本信息,可能需要重新安装Python。

  3. 设置环境变量:确保Python的安装路径已经添加到了环境变量中。可以通过修改.bash_profile.zshrc文件来添加路径。

    • 打开终端,编辑环境变量文件:open ~/.bash_profileopen ~/.zshrc

      复制代码
      open ~/.bash_profile
    • 添加路径:export PATH="/usr/local/bin:$PATH"(这里的路径需要替换为你的Python实际安装路径)。

      复制代码
      export PATH="/usr/local/bin:$PATH"
    • 保存文件并在终端执行source ~/.bash_profilesource ~/.zshrc来使变更生效。

      复制代码
      source ~/.bash_profile

如果以上步骤仍然无法解决问题,可能需要更详细的错误信息来进行具体的故障排除。

相关推荐
捉鸭子5 分钟前
某音a_bogus vmp逆向
爬虫·python·web安全·node.js·js
曲幽16 分钟前
FastAPI 生产环境静态文件完全指南:从 /favicon.ico 404 到 HSTS 混合内容,一次全根治
python·fastapi·web·static·media·404·hsts·favicon·url_for
Dontla17 分钟前
Python asyncpg库介绍(基于Python asyncio的PostgreSQL数据库驱动)连接池、SQLAlchemy
数据库·python·postgresql
zh15702326 分钟前
如何编写动态SQL存储过程_使用sp_executesql执行灵活查询
jvm·数据库·python
2401_8242226930 分钟前
SQL报表统计数据量巨大_分批统计策略
jvm·数据库·python
X566133 分钟前
mysql如何处理连接数过多报错_调整max_connections参数
jvm·数据库·python
m0_609160491 小时前
MongoDB中什么是Hashed Shard Key的哈希冲突_哈希函数的分布均匀性分析
jvm·数据库·python
Ulyanov1 小时前
《现代 Python 桌面应用架构实战:PySide6 + QML 从入门到工程化》 开发环境搭建与工具链极简主义 —— 拒绝臃肿,构建工业级基座
开发语言·python·qt·ui·架构·系统仿真
wuxinyan1231 小时前
大模型学习之路03:提示工程从入门到精通(第三篇)
人工智能·python·学习
如何原谅奋力过但无声1 小时前
【灵神高频面试题合集01-03】相向双指针、滑动窗口
数据结构·python·算法·leetcode